In the last few hours, the publisher Dangen Entertainment and the developer Yakov Butuzoff have announced the release date of the psychological thriller Loretta: will be available on PC dal 16 February. A new trailer was also released for the occasion, which you can see at the bottom of the news.

Loretta is a psychological thriller that makes the player an accomplice to the protagonist’s crimes, leading her into a nightmare of her own making.
Loretta’s story revolves around a woman who faces her husband’s betrayal, infidelity and reclaims her independence during the tumultuous 1940s. Choose the dialogues, interact with the objects and decide how far Loretta’s depravity goes as she navigates a nightmare of her own creation.
History
Loretta is a housewife. Her husband Walter is a writer. Dragged by the glitz and glamor of New York and thrust into a rundown farm in the rural South, both are unsuccessful, struggling with their finances and their relationship. But when Loretta learns of her husband’s infidelity and an extraordinarily lucrative life insurance policy in his name, a macabre plan begins to take hold. It is up to the player to decide how far to follow it.
Characteristics
Decide whether Loretta’s story will remain a web of deception or grow into bloody murder through dialogue and discovery. Conceptually inspired by film noir, the art of Andrew Wyeth and Edward Hopper, and the works of Alfred Hitchcock, Philip Ridley, Stephen King and Vladimir Nabokov. Solve cryptic puzzles to delve into Loretta’s flawed past and discover the levels of despair she feels to regain control of her life. Which side will you take in this story without heroes? Branching paths and multiple endings allow you to customize the experience or replay it. Choose Loretta’s fate and explore the many opportunities that are presented to her.
